GAMBIA: Incommunicado detention/ Fear of torture or ill-treatment "Mubarak" (m), Moroccan national

Amnesty International is concerned for the safety of a Moroccan national, known as Mubarak. He was arrested on 30 December 2002 in Farafenni, Gambia, as he reportedly arrived in the country. There are fears that he may be subjected to intimidation, ill-treatment or other cruel inhuman or degrading treatment
